[Bug 2078307] [NEW] Grub 2.12 is unable to boot the Windows system using the chainloader /efi/Microsoft/Boot/bootmgfw.efi.

Public bug reported:
I am using Shim 15.8 in combination with GRUB2.12. One of the GRUB menu
items, chainloader /efi/Microsoft/Boot/bootmgfw.efi, fails to boot,
while it works correctly with GRUB2.06. Below is a screenshot of the
error.
